You can connect that app through iOS, Android with Bluetooth connection.
You can load your firearm profiles, all that stuff in it.
So it will actually calculate for your rifle, etc.,
Now, the features of this, of course, it's got ED glass lenses for extra low dispersion.
The diopters, once you focus them, it's one for each eye, of course, because binoculars, you can lock them.
It's got a little standalone fire button for the ranging.
It's got different mode buttons, wind buttons.
Now it's got a,
OLED 8 heads-up display for what you're looking at.
Wind speed can be entered in half-mile-per-hour increments.
Now, it has onboard sensors for atmospheric conditions.
It gives you relatively wind, internal compass, adjusts for wind direction at where you're viewing it at, but of course,
It's got beam correction.
Of course, it shows you wind direction, reticle options, depending on what you're looking for, circle, oval, cross, two MOA dot or one MOA dot.
It's got different target modes, including like snow, rain, or you're going extended ranges.
It's got a bow mode.
So if you're, you know, flicking sticks at stuff, you know, it can do that.
You know, it does either MLA or MRAD options depending on what you want.
The ballistic app features pretty much everything you need, including Coriolis effect, spin drift, aerodynamic jump, tripod shooting, air correction, wind calculation, corrections, flight time, basically a ton of stuff.
